Either ALL your callbacks need to end with an "end" statement, or NONE OF THEM do. You can't have some end with an end and others end without an end. My style is that I don't include the final "end" on function definitions. You can use either style but you have to be consistent within an m-file.

Image Analyst
Image Analyst 2012-3-23
But otherwise, here's a snippet of code I use called LoadImageList(). You can call it when you start up your code (in the OpenFcn function), or, for example, in the callback for the "Specify folder" button where the user browses to the folder they want (using uigetdir or uipickfiles). Don't be afraid of the length. It's just a little long because it's so well commented and robust. I'm sure once you read through it line by line you can understand it. You could make it shorter if you wanted by concatenating a bunch or dir() outputs if you want rather than by filtering the files by extension.
%=====================================================================
% Load up the listbox, lstImageList, with image files
% in the folder handles.CalibrationFolder.
function handles = LoadImageList(handles)
try
% Get the folder into a handy variable name.
% (Change handles.CalibrationFolder as needed for your situation.)
folder = handles.CalibrationFolder;
% Check that the folder actually exists.
if ~isempty(folder)
% Folder is not empty. There is actually some text in it.
if ~exist(folder,'dir')
% Folder does not exist on disk.
WarnUser(['Folder ' folder ' does not exist.']);
return;
end
else
% Folder is empty/null.
WarnUser('ERROR: No folder specified as input for function LoadImageList.');
return;
end
% If it gets to here, the folder exists.
% Get a list of all files in the folder.
filePattern = fullfile(folder, '/*.*');
ImageFiles = dir(filePattern);
% Filter the list to pick out only files of
% file types that we want (image and video files).
ListOfImageNames = {}; % Initialize
for Index = 1:length(ImageFiles)
% Get the base filename and extension.
baseFileName = ImageFiles(Index).name;
[folder, name, extension] = fileparts(baseFileName);
% Examine extensions for ones we want.
extension = upper(extension);
switch lower(extension)
case {'.png', '.bmp', '.jpg', '.tif', '.avi'}
% Keep only PNG, BMP, JPG, TIF, or AVI image files.
ListOfImageNames = [ListOfImageNames baseFileName];
% otherwise
end
end
% Now we have a list of validated filenames that we want.
% Send the list of validated filenames to the listbox.
set(handles.lstImageList, 'string', ListOfImageNames);
catch ME
% Alert the user of the error.
errorMessage = sprintf('Error in LoadImageList().\nThe error reported by MATLAB is:\n\n%s', ME.message);
WarnUser(errorMessage); % WarnUser code is uiwait(warndlg(errorMessage));
% Print the error message out to a static text on the GUI.
set(handles.txtInfo, 'String', errorMessage);
end
return; % from LoadImageList()
%--------------------------------
function WarnUser(warningMessage)
uiwait(warndlg(warningMessage));
return; % from WarnUser()
